FENDER SILVERFACE CHAMP
1968-1982
Configuration: Combo
Power: 6 Watts
Effects: None
SCHEMATIC
LAYOUT
- Front Panel: In, In, Volume, Treble, Bass, Power Switch, Pilot Light
- Back Panel: Fuse, Speaker Jack
CABINET
- Tolex: Black
- Grill Cloth: Blue / White / Silver w/ Aluminum Frame (68-69) w/o Aluminum Frame (70-75) Orange / Silver (76-80)
- Logo: Grill Mounted, Raised, Chrome & Black Script w/ Tail (68-74) or w/o Tail (74-82)
- Handle: Black Strap
- Feet: Chrome Glides
- Knobs: Black Skirted w/ Chrome Center, Numbered 1 - 10
- Hardware: Small Chassis Straps 3 5/8"
SPEAKER
- Size: 1 x 8
- Impedance: 3.2 ohms
- Model: Oxford 8EV (For more info, check out the Mojotone Replacement Speaker Guide)
TUBES
- Pre amp: 7025
- Power: 6V6GT
- Bias: Cathode Bias
- Rectifier: 5Y3
Comments: The speaker jack and fuse (1A) are located under chassis. Fender switched back to the Blackface era cosmetics in 1982. Champs produced in 1982 have a black control panel and Black / White / Silver sparkle grill cloth.
